T63.512D
ICD-10-CMToxic effect of contact with stingray, intentional self-harm, subsequent encounter
This code describes a follow-up visit for a patient who intentionally harmed themselves by making contact with a stingray. The injury is a result of a deliberate act, not an accidental encounter. This indicates ongoing care related to the initial self-inflicted stingray injury.
Use this code for subsequent encounters when a patient presents for follow-up care, wound management, or mental health evaluation related to a self-inflicted stingray injury. This applies after the initial treatment of the acute injury. It should be used when the intent of self-harm is clearly documented.
